在linux / chrome OS上检查多体系结构?

时间:2018-12-30 18:42:20

标签: linux bash cpu-architecture google-chrome-os multiarch

我正在Chromebook Plux V2(具有x86_64架构,但没有多体系结构支持)上为AROC制作修复程序,我想在他的脚本中运行测试以对其进行检查。我可以使用什么命令来检查Linux x86_64系统上的多体系结构?

(仅参考原始问题)在该Chromebook(脚本安装的device could not run the i686 busybox binary)上部署AROC时。

作者坚持使用i686二进制文件,因为他测试部署的android容器在具有多体系结构的主机系统上是32位的。

我的目标是修复他的脚本并增加对我正在测试的设备的支持。

我打算这样做,方法是检查多体系结构,如果存在32位运行时,则安装i686二进制文件;如果不存在,则安装x86_64二进制文件。我可以使用什么命令检查多体系结构?

1 个答案:

答案 0 :(得分:0)

您要问的是多库支持,而不是多体系结构。

您可以简单地检查一下是否存在32位ldso:test -e /lib/ld-linux.so.2